American Education Week: November 16–20, 2020

American Education Week presents everyone with an opportunity to celebrate public education and honor individuals who are making a difference in ensuring that every student receives a quality education. Be sure to thank a teacher, teaching assistant, staff member, custodian, cafeteria worker and substitute teacher today!
